Benefits
Motion controllers are used to achieve some desired benefit(s) which can include:
- increased position and speed accuracy
- higher speeds
- faster reaction time
- increased production
- smoother movements
- reduction in costs
- integration with other automation
- integration with other processes
- ability to convert desired specifications into motion required to produce a product
- increased information and ability diagnose and troubleshoot
- increased consistency
- improved efficiency
- elimination of hazards to humans or animals
